On February 20th, 2003, the city of West Warwick, Rhode Island was shaken by tragedy when a fire broke out at the Station nightclub. All in all, it took less than … can i fire my property managerWebTheir performance featured pyrotechnics, a gimmick typical of heavy metal bands, but one Great White hadn't used in 20 years of touring together. Shortly after 11p.m., a spark ignited some foam around the stage. The nightclub was soon engulfed.
